summaryrefslogtreecommitdiffstats
path: root/Makefile
diff options
context:
space:
mode:
authorarpi <arpi@b3059339-0415-0410-9bf9-f77b7e298cf2>2003-02-20 23:32:47 +0000
committerarpi <arpi@b3059339-0415-0410-9bf9-f77b7e298cf2>2003-02-20 23:32:47 +0000
commita5f6871128e56fb1eaa08ca8039ff7286efe3f3c (patch)
tree71c93b5007c736b9545f6240847afae780e7107d /Makefile
parentded01a9a5ba70e81d77da82e85a72d4e365776e3 (diff)
downloadmpv-a5f6871128e56fb1eaa08ca8039ff7286efe3f3c.tar.bz2
mpv-a5f6871128e56fb1eaa08ca8039ff7286efe3f3c.tar.xz
Latest version has the following features:
- --language=ab,cd,ef and --language="ab cd ef" are supported, the list is now used as a fallback for possible message/gui translations - --language=all is supported - --language=ab,cd,ef,all and --language="ab cd ef all" are supported for all man pages, but different message/gui translations than en - $LINGUAS is honored - if no --language or $LINGUAS is given it defaults to en Credits for ideas go out to (in no particular order): Tobias Diedrich Sylvain Petreolle Dan Christiansen Dominik Mierzejewski Andriy N. Gritsenko and everyone I've forgotten Andreas Hess <jaska@gmx.net> git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@9471 b3059339-0415-0410-9bf9-f77b7e298cf2
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ile29
1 files changed, 13 insertions, 16 deletions
diff --git a/Makefile b/Makefile
index 39c95ffa5e..87e7db134f 100644
--- a/Makefile
+++ b/Makefile
@@ -246,26 +246,23 @@ ifeq ($(GUI),yes)
-ln -sf $(PRG) $(BINDIR)/gmplayer
endif
if test ! -d $(MANDIR)/man1 ; then mkdir -p $(MANDIR)/man1; fi
- $(INSTALL) -c -m 644 DOCS/en/mplayer.1 $(MANDIR)/man1/mplayer.1
- @if [ -n "$(LANGUAGES)" ]; then \
- for i in $(LANGUAGES); do \
- if [ -f DOCS/$$i/mplayer.1 ]; then \
- echo "Installing manual for language $$i" ; \
- mkdir -p $(MANDIR)/$$i/man1 ; \
- $(INSTALL) -c -m 644 DOCS/$$i/mplayer.1 $(MANDIR)/$$i/man1/mplayer.1 ; \
+ for i in $(LANGUAGES); do \
+ if test "$$i" = en ; then \
+ $(INSTALL) -c -m 644 DOCS/en/mplayer.1 $(MANDIR)/man1/mplayer.1 ; \
+ else \
+ mkdir -p $(MANDIR)/$$i/man1 ; \
+ $(INSTALL) -c -m 644 DOCS/$$i/mplayer.1 $(MANDIR)/$$i/man1/mplayer.1 ; \
fi ; \
- done ; \
- fi
+ done
ifeq ($(MENCODER),yes)
$(INSTALL) -m 755 $(INSTALLSTRIP) $(PRG_MENCODER) $(BINDIR)/$(PRG_MENCODER)
- ln -sf mplayer.1 $(MANDIR)/man1/mencoder.1
- @if [ -n "$(LANGUAGES)" ]; then \
- for i in $(LANGUAGES); do \
- if [ -f DOCS/$$i/mplayer.1 ]; then \
- ln -sf mplayer.1 $(MANDIR)/$$i/man1/mencoder.1 ; \
+ for i in $(LANGUAGES); do \
+ if test "$$i" = en ; then \
+ ln -sf mplayer.1 $(MANDIR)/man1/mencoder.1 ; \
+ else \
+ ln -sf mplayer.1 $(MANDIR)/$$i/man1/mencoder.1 ; \
fi ; \
- done ; \
- fi
+ done
endif
@if test ! -d $(DATADIR) ; then mkdir -p $(DATADIR) ; fi
@if test ! -d $(DATADIR)/font ; then mkdir -p $(DATADIR)/font ; fi